System requirements
We recommend that you choose a fault-tolerant dedicated or virtual server that is based on hypervisor virtualization or OVZ container virtualization.
Hardware requirements
The main load on the server is provided by the sites located on it. We advise you to keep in mind that sites with databases and mailboxes use more server resources.
Component | Requirements for the control panel | Requirements for the control panel and up to 10 websites | Requirements for the control panel and more than 10 websites |
---|---|---|---|
CPU | 1 core | 1 core | 2 core or more |
RAM | 1 Gb | 2 Gb or more | 3 Gb or more |
Disk space | 10 Gb | 20 Gb or more | 50 Gb or more |
We recommend allocating all disk space for the root file system.
It is recommended to have at least 4 Gb of RAM to ensure efficient operation:
- when using alternative database versions on a server with ispmanager;
- when selecting MySQL database server during installation.
Software requirements
We strongly recommend to install ispmanager on a "clean" server. You should install a minimal version of the operating system, all the services that ispmanager requires will be installed automatically during software installation.
- To ensure the best software performance, do not connect any third-party repositories.
- When installing ispmanager on an OVZ virtual server, check that the version of the OS kernel on the host server is not less than 2.6.32-042stab134.
- The server with the control panel must use the static IP address specified in the network interface configuration file. If the IP address is assigned to the server using DHCP, the correct operation of the control panel is not guaranteed.
- Use the OS server version, desktop OS version is not supported.
- You should install the panel on the server with the latest minor version of the operating system.
- Do not change the major version of the OS, otherwise technical support will not be provided.
Supported operating systems (x64):
- AlmaLinux 8, 9;
- Debian 11; 12;
- Ubuntu 20.04, 22.04 (recommended);
- Rocky Linux 8.
CloudLinux OS SHARED also supported.
Since January 2022, support for CentOS 8 has ended. Installation and operation of the control panel on a server with CentOS 8 is not supported. You can migrate to AlmaLinux 8 OS according to the instructions.
Updates on servers with an outdated OS
Firewall settings
Open the following ports to allow incoming and outgoing connections:
- 21/tcp — to send data via FTP;
- 22/tcp — for remote access to a server via SSH;
- 110, 143, 993, 995, 587, 465, 25/tcp — to send and receive emails;
- 80, 443/tcp — to handle user requests to websites on the server with ispmanager;
- 1500/tcp —to access the ispmanager interface;
- 1501/tcp - to run external applications via SSL;
- 53/tcp, 53/udp — for domain name servers;
- 3306/tcp — for remote access to the database server.
To ensure uninterrupted access to the license servers, make sure the following server addresses are always available:
212.109.222.131
212.109.222.143
144.76.174.134